Fresh Cherry Sauce
Description
The Fresh Cherry Sauce brings out the natural sweetness and tartness of ripe cherries, cooked until they soften and release their juices. The addition of sugar balances the acidity, while the lemon juice brightens the flavor and the cornstarch mixture gives the sauce its thick, glossy consistency. A hint of almond or vanilla extract adds subtle background notes that enhance the fruit without overpowering it.
This sauce can be served warm or cold and works as a topping for ice cream, pancakes, yogurt, or cakes. It's a versatile condiment that adds fruit flavor and moisture to a variety of dishes.
If you find the sauce too thin after cooling, gently reheating it with a little more dissolved cornstarch will help achieve the desired thickness.
Ingredients
- 2 lbs Cherry fresh, pitted
- 1/2 cup water
- 1/2 cup sugar more if you like it sweeter
- 2 tsp cornstarch
- 2 tsp lemon juice
- 1 tsp almond extract optional, or vanilla extract
Instructions
- Put the cherries, water, and sugar in a heavy saucepan. Bring to a full boil over medium high heat, stirring to dissolve the sugar. Cook for a few minutes while the cherries start to release their juices.
- Stir the cornstarch together with the lemon juice and add to the pan. Continue to stir and cook until the sauce has thickened and is glossy, this will only take a minute or two. Remove from the heat and stir in the extract.
- Let the sauce cool, then put into jars or an airtight container and refrigerate until needed. You can use it cold, room temperature, or warmed up.
- Makes 1 1/2 quarts.
Notes
- If the sauce is not thick enough after cooling, gently reheat it with additional dissolved cornstarch until desired consistency is reached.
- The sauce can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ator and used cold, at room temperature, or warmed.
- Use fresh, ripe cherries and ensure they are pitted for best flavor and texture.
